(BRZE)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.10, falling short of the consensus estimate of $0.1405 — a negative surprise of 28.83%. Revenue figures were not provided in the preliminary data. Despite the earnings miss, the stock rose 4.02% in after-market trading, suggesting investors may have focused on other positive developments or forward-looking commentary.
